It is reported that east China Anhui province is to strengthen the regulating and eliminating work on non coal mines due to rising accidents this year.
Mr Zhu Feng deputy director general of Anhui Administration of Work Safety said those still unqualified after rectification would be definitely closed. While those capable for resources consolidation or capacity expansion through technical innovation, should submit their proposals to related government bodies for approval.
By the end of June, the province has shut down 9 underground mines, 55 open pit mines and 11 tailings. And Mr Zhu said local government is aiming to close 30 metals and non metals underground mines, 100 open pit mines and 20 tailings by the end of this year.
